Dead Key Fob Battery

One of the most frequent reasons for a key fob's slow response is that its battery has gone out of service. It's time to replace your battery if are finding yourself pressing the unlock button a few times before your car responds, or if it isn't locking as well as it used to. It's easy to replace the battery on the key fob.

Press the unlock button a few times to ensure that the fob is working. If you're confident that it's not malfunctioning because it's out of range, there are a few things you can do to get it back. Ensure you have your fob. If there is enough power in the battery, you can turn it on it by pressing it against the door handle.

Then, ensure that you have the correct type of battery, which will be embossed on the fob. It's usually a button cell that is sold by brands such as Duracell and Energizer. When you have the correct battery, remove your old one and replace it with the new one. Make sure that the positive side is facing upwards. The fob halves should be snapped together and test the lock key repair near me/unlock/start functions.

If you want to ensure your safety then you can take the fob along to a watch repair shop or your local car dealership and ask them to replace the battery on your behalf. This is likely to cost you a bit more than if doing it yourself, but it's a good idea to have someone else do it so you don't end up damaging the circuit board while trying to open the fob to change the battery.

You can save money by purchasing a CR2032 from an online retailer or hardware store. Follow the instructions in your owner's guide (which is available online in PDF format on the manufacturer's website or on YouTube), to change the battery in the fob. It's a very simple procedure that will restore the useful functions of the remote key repair you rely on for your journeys around Springfield.

Buttons Damaged

While it may seem odd that the key fob inside your car requires maintenance however, they do. These issues are generally not serious and can be solved by replacing the battery. Other issues may be noticed that indicate the keyfob needs more attention.

The power button may be the reason for your key fob not working or the buttons not working. Cell buttons can be subjected to a beating due to wear and tear and the internal components could be damaged or ripped loose causing the button to fail. There are kits for DIY to replace power buttons, but dealing with these tiny and delicate pieces can be challenging to say the least. Attempting to replace the power button can be dangerous as there is a real possibility of damaging the inside circuitry.

Some automotive locksmiths have specialized equipment for this type of repair, and they can complete the task while you're waiting. They can fix the buttons and get them looking like new in just a few minutes.

In the event that you don't have the luxury of a professional You can buy aftermarket key fobs that appear exactly like your original key fob at a fraction of the price. Some automotive retailers and some dealerships will let you program them with your vehicle, but some will not. Genesky says he can program his fobs with most cars made since the '90s but he's forced to deny customers with more recent Audi or BMW models due to the fact that he does not have the equipment needed to program them.

Examine your car's warranty to see whether it covers the cost of a replacement key fob, or at a minimum part of the cost. This will allow you to decide if it's worth the cost of a key fob repair or buying a new one.

Issues with the Circuitry

Your key fob is subject to lots of abuse and stress when you use it, since it is dropped, tossed and exposed to heat and cold on a regular basis. This can cause damage to internal components, particularly the tiny electronic circuit board inside which sends signals to your car. In the event of damage, these signals could not function properly and stop you from opening your door or even starting your car.

If you have tried replacing the battery, but it doesn't work, there's a chance that your fob needs to be reprogrammed for your specific make and model of vehicle. This can be done through a dealer, or a professional repair shop with experience in your vehicle. This is a very simple procedure that takes only a few minutes to complete.

Another possibility is that the fob casing may be worn out, which can cause it to lose contact with internal components. The casing contains contacts, which are rubber-like components coated in electricity-conducting film that assist with sending the signal to your car. These can wear out over time or even snap off completely. A simple replacement casing should restore your fob's functionality.

Sometimes, your key fob only has to be changed to reflect the current year model, make, and model of your vehicle. This is a simple solution that you can accomplish at home or by a professional if you have an extra fob. The procedure is generally simple and only involves following a few steps from your manufacturer's website or your local dealership's service center.

It is possible that your key fob needs to be replaced entirely However, this is typically more expensive and can require visiting the dealer or an independent shop with expertise in your particular brand and model. Replacing a key fob typically the best option if it isn't working correctly and you don't want to risk getting stuck somewhere. Depending on the make and model, replacements may cost anywhere from $50 to $150 or more.
